How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 54494?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
54494 Studio Apartments | $754 | $650 | $800 |
54494 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,056 | $940 | $1,115 |
54494 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,043 | $750 | $1,350 |
54494 3 Bedroom Apartments | $847 | $545 | $1,295 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 54494 ZIP Code
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 54494 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 54494 range from $750 to $1,350.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,043.
How expensive are 54494 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 9 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 54494 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$545 to $1,295 - averaging $847 for the location.
